5. Give Me Liberty
In Season 6 Episode 5 'Give Me Liberty', Outlander shifts focus to the politics of the upcoming civil war. It brings back Lord John Grey (David Berry) and Bonnie Prince Charlie (Andrew Gower) and introduces Flora MacDonald (Shauna MacDonald).

6. Hour of the Wolf
Season 6 Episode 4 'Hour of the Wolf' is all about Young Ian (John Bell). Finally, we hear the tragic story of his past with the Mohawk as he opens up to Jamie.

7. I Am Not Alone
Episode 8 'I Am Not Alone' is the Outlander Season 6 finale, which sees Claire and Jamie Fraser fight for their freedom at Fraser's Ridge. An explosive episode, this finale left fans desperate for answers in Season 7.

8. Sticks and Stones
Season 6 Episode 7 'Sticks and Stones' deals with the fallout from a shocking incident: there's a murderer on the loose in Fraser's Ridge. A lighter sub plot involving Lizzie (Caitlin O' Ryan) and the Beardsley twins (Paul Gorman) adds a splash of humour to the penultimate episode.
